Last week more than 50 checkout operators from Taranaki New World, PAK'nSAVE and Shoprite stores tested their skills onstage at the TSB Showplace in New Plymouth in the hopes of taking out the title of Foodstuffs North Island Checker of the Year.
Owner operator of Stratford New World, Craig Waite, says he is delighted with the results achieved by their team, with six staff members placing in the top 12.
"In fact, the top five contained four members of our team, with Malissa Alexander and Jacinta Frost taking second and third place respectively."
The checkers were judged by a team of eight senior Foodstuffs staff on their speed, presentation, customer service and accuracy as they scanned 30 items as fast as possible, while also staying friendly and composed.
"Our Checker of the Year competition has being going for over 40 years, and is a fun night for checkers to demonstrate their fantastic customer service skills and engage in a bit of friendly competition with other stores," says event organiser Kristie McGregor.
